Mitchell’s WWE NXT Results & Report! (6/7/22)

Time to break out!

Published

on

Who makes history as the first NXT Women’s Breakout winner?

Roxanne Perez or Tiffany Stratton. Only one can be the first to put their name on the NXT Women’s Breakout Championship Contract!

OFFICIAL RESULTS

  • Von Wagner w/ Robert Stone VS Josh Briggs w/ Brooks Jensen & Fallon Henley; Briggs wins.
  • Santos Escobar w/ The D’Angelo Familia VS Nathan Frazer; Frazer wins.
  • NXT Women’s Breakout Tournament Finals: Roxanne Perez VS Tiffany Stratton; Perez wins and earns the NXT Women’s Breakout Tournament Championship Contract.
  • Chase U VS Pretty Deadly; changed to…
  • Handicap Match: Pretty Deadly VS Andre Chase; Pretty Deadly wins.
  • Alba Fyre VS Tatum Paxley; Fyre wins.
  • Grayson Waller & Carmelo Hayes w/ Trick Williams VS Solo Sikoa & Apollo Crews; Sikoa & Crews win.

My Thoughts:

A great episode for NXT, especially to follow In Your House. For one, great to see them follow on the story of The Don taking over Legado right away, and not in any way that’s too stupid or degrading for Legado. Pretty sure they got some rather interesting political social commentary with that redistricting line, but I don’t know Florida politics. Either way, it was a great move for Tony to force Escobar to have an “impromptu” match with Frazer. Escobar VS Frazer was a great match, Tony criticizing Escobar’s wrestling style was a great detail, and of course Frazer wins because Tony and his guys kept distracting him. This will all lead to Legado losing their cool and uprising against Tony D.

I really liked what they gave us in the tag division tonight. For one, Strong can’t help but create tension between him and the rest of Diamond Mine. He disapproved the Creeds giving Malik & Edris a shot, and he might try to get involved in the match again like he did with Viking Raiders and Pretty Deadly. The Creeds will retain and this thing with Strong will come to a head in time for Great American Bash 2022. Pretty Deadly had a good interaction with Chase U, and of course they’d attack Bodhi to give themselves an advantage. I really liked the bit where Thea wanted to tag in even though it wasn’t co-ed, and there has to be a moment where Thea proves herself in a big match.

Good match from Tatum against Fyre but of course Fyre wins. Fyre hitting that Swanton from corner to center was great stuff. And of course Lash attacks Fyre in a classic Heel move. Fyre VS Lash will be another good match, and I suppose Lash could win with cheating, but Fyre should win to build more momentum towards the title. Roxie VS Tiffany was a great match for the Breakout Tournament finals, and I wish this was the main event just on principle of the historic match being the most important. Roxie wins because duh, all the champions are Heels. And naturally, the champions showed up to talk down to Roxie.

We got a great brawl, and Indi showing up could mean Roxie uses her contract to get her and Cora a tag title match, and Indi gets a fair match with Mandy for the top title. I kinda hope this is where Toxic Attraction loses, so that Indi can join Io Shirai and Raquel Gonzalez in having the top title and the tag titles in their careers. The only thing Indi doesn’t have that those two do have is a Dusty Cup trophy. Also, an interesting move that Wendy and Tiffany are having another feud after both of them lost the big prizes. Maybe Wendy wins this time since she has the fans behind her much stronger this time.

Bron Breakker had a decent enough promo giving some credit to Gacy, but the big moment was Apollo’s return to NXT, and not having the Nigerian Prince gimmick or even accent. Vince and team really let the ball drop on that one. They moved Apollo & Azeez to Raw but then kinda forgot about them the last few months. Apollo will surely make his way to the top title, but it was great for him to join Solo against Waller and Melo. Great set-up to this with the segment where Melo said Grimes’ promise is null and void, and then we got a great tag team match. Solo and Apollo win, they’ve got momentum towards titles, but it’d be quite the twist if Apollo got in on the North American title match. Apollo VS Melo 1v1 would be awesome stuff, too, but I would think Solo is meant to dethrone Melo.
